Commit b6db69bb authored by Philip Carns's avatar Philip Carns

switch to psm2:// prefix

parent 57630ae4
......@@ -26,30 +26,30 @@ echo "### NOTE: all benchmarks are using numactl to keep processes on socket 0"
echo "## Bake OFI/PSM2 (bdw):"
rm -f /dev/shm/foo.dat
bake-mkpool -s 60G /dev/shm/foo.dat
srun numactl -N 0 -m 0 ./bake-p2p-bw -x 16777216 -m 34359738368 -n ofi+psm2://enp6s0f0:5000 -p /dev/shm/foo.dat -c 1
srun numactl -N 0 -m 0 ./bake-p2p-bw -x 16777216 -m 34359738368 -n psm2:// -p /dev/shm/foo.dat -c 1
echo "## Bake OFI/PSM2 (8x concurrency, bdw):"
rm -f /dev/shm/foo.dat
bake-mkpool -s 60G /dev/shm/foo.dat
srun numactl -N 0 -m 0 ./bake-p2p-bw -x 16777216 -m 34359738368 -n ofi+psm2://enp6s0f0:5000 -p /dev/shm/foo.dat -c 8
srun numactl -N 0 -m 0 ./bake-p2p-bw -x 16777216 -m 34359738368 -n psm2:// -p /dev/shm/foo.dat -c 8
echo "## Bake OFI/PSM2 (bdw, 12 rpc es):"
rm -f /dev/shm/foo.dat
bake-mkpool -s 60G /dev/shm/foo.dat
srun numactl -N 0 -m 0 ./bake-p2p-bw -x 16777216 -m 34359738368 -n ofi+psm2://enp6s0f0:5000 -p /dev/shm/foo.dat -c 1 -r 12
srun numactl -N 0 -m 0 ./bake-p2p-bw -x 16777216 -m 34359738368 -n psm2:// -p /dev/shm/foo.dat -c 1 -r 12
echo "## Bake OFI/PSM2 (8x concurrency, bdw, 12 rpc es):"
rm -f /dev/shm/foo.dat
bake-mkpool -s 60G /dev/shm/foo.dat
srun numactl -N 0 -m 0 ./bake-p2p-bw -x 16777216 -m 34359738368 -n ofi+psm2://enp6s0f0:5000 -p /dev/shm/foo.dat -c 8 -r 12
srun numactl -N 0 -m 0 ./bake-p2p-bw -x 16777216 -m 34359738368 -n psm2:// -p /dev/shm/foo.dat -c 8 -r 12
echo "## Bake OFI/PSM2 (bdw, 12 rpc es, pipelining):"
rm -f /dev/shm/foo.dat
bake-mkpool -s 60G /dev/shm/foo.dat
srun numactl -N 0 -m 0 ./bake-p2p-bw -x 16777216 -m 34359738368 -n ofi+psm2://enp6s0f0:5000 -p /dev/shm/foo.dat -c 1 -r 12 -i
srun numactl -N 0 -m 0 ./bake-p2p-bw -x 16777216 -m 34359738368 -n psm2:// -p /dev/shm/foo.dat -c 1 -r 12 -i
echo "## Bake OFI/PSM2 (8x concurrency, bdw, 12 rpc es, pipelining):"
rm -f /dev/shm/foo.dat
bake-mkpool -s 60G /dev/shm/foo.dat
srun numactl -N 0 -m 0 ./bake-p2p-bw -x 16777216 -m 34359738368 -n ofi+psm2://enp6s0f0:5000 -p /dev/shm/foo.dat -c 8 -r 12 -i
srun numactl -N 0 -m 0 ./bake-p2p-bw -x 16777216 -m 34359738368 -n psm2:// -p /dev/shm/foo.dat -c 8 -r 12 -i
......@@ -24,40 +24,40 @@ export PSM2_MULTI_EP=1
echo "### NOTE: all benchmarks are using numactl to keep processes on socket 0"
echo "## Margo OFI/PSM2 (round trip, bdw):"
mpirun numactl -N 0 -m 0 ./margo-p2p-latency -i 100000 -n ofi+psm2://enp6s0f0:5000
mpirun numactl -N 0 -m 0 ./margo-p2p-latency -i 100000 -n psm2://
echo "## Margo OFI/PSM2 (bw, 1MiB, bdw):"
mpirun numactl -N 0 -m 0 ./margo-p2p-bw -x 1048576 -n ofi+psm2://enp6s0f0:5000 -c 1 -D 20
mpirun numactl -N 0 -m 0 ./margo-p2p-bw -x 1048576 -n psm2:// -c 1 -D 20
echo "## Margo OFI/PSM2 (bw, 1MiB, 8x concurrency, bdw):"
mpirun numactl -N 0 -m 0 ./margo-p2p-bw -x 1048576 -n ofi+psm2://enp6s0f0:5000 -c 8 -D 20
mpirun numactl -N 0 -m 0 ./margo-p2p-bw -x 1048576 -n psm2:// -c 8 -D 20
echo "## Margo OFI/PSM2 (bw, 8MiB, bdw):"
mpirun numactl -N 0 -m 0 ./margo-p2p-bw -x 8388608 -n ofi+psm2://enp6s0f0:5000 -c 1 -D 20
mpirun numactl -N 0 -m 0 ./margo-p2p-bw -x 8388608 -n psm2:// -c 1 -D 20
echo "## Margo OFI/PSM2 (bw, 8MiB, 8x concurrency, bdw):"
mpirun numactl -N 0 -m 0 ./margo-p2p-bw -x 8388608 -n ofi+psm2://enp6s0f0:5000 -c 8 -D 20
mpirun numactl -N 0 -m 0 ./margo-p2p-bw -x 8388608 -n psm2:// -c 8 -D 20
echo "## Margo OFI/PSM2 (bw, 1MB unaligned, bdw):"
mpirun numactl -N 0 -m 0 ./margo-p2p-bw -x 1000000 -n ofi+psm2://enp6s0f0:5000 -c 1 -D 20
mpirun numactl -N 0 -m 0 ./margo-p2p-bw -x 1000000 -n psm2:// -c 1 -D 20
echo "## Margo OFI/PSM2 (bw, 1MB unaligned, 8x concurrency, bdw):"
mpirun numactl -N 0 -m 0 ./margo-p2p-bw -x 1000000 -n ofi+psm2://enp6s0f0:5000 -c 8 -D 20
mpirun numactl -N 0 -m 0 ./margo-p2p-bw -x 1000000 -n psm2:// -c 8 -D 20
# echo "## Margo OFI/PSM2 (bw, 8MiB, mmap shmfs on svr, bdw):"
# mpirun numactl -N 0 -m 0 ./margo-p2p-bw -x 8388608 -n ofi+psm2://enp6s0f0:5000 -c 1 -D 20 -m /dev/shm/foo
# mpirun numactl -N 0 -m 0 ./margo-p2p-bw -x 8388608 -n psm2:// -c 1 -D 20 -m /dev/shm/foo
# echo "## Margo OFI/PSM2 (bw, 8MiB, mmap shmfs on svr, 8x concurrency, bdw):"
# mpirun numactl -N 0 -m 0 ./margo-p2p-bw -x 8388608 -n ofi+psm2://enp6s0f0:5000 -c 8 -D 20 -m /dev/shm/foo
# mpirun numactl -N 0 -m 0 ./margo-p2p-bw -x 8388608 -n psm2:// -c 8 -D 20 -m /dev/shm/foo
echo "## Margo OFI/PSM2 (round trip, bdw, Hg busy spin):"
mpirun numactl -N 0 -m 0 ./margo-p2p-latency -i 100000 -n ofi+psm2://enp6s0f0:5000 -t 0,0
mpirun numactl -N 0 -m 0 ./margo-p2p-latency -i 100000 -n psm2:// -t 0,0
echo "## Margo OFI/PSM2 (bw, 1MiB, bdw, Hg busy spin):"
mpirun numactl -N 0 -m 0 ./margo-p2p-bw -x 1048576 -n ofi+psm2://enp6s0f0:5000 -c 1 -D 20 -t 0,0
mpirun numactl -N 0 -m 0 ./margo-p2p-bw -x 1048576 -n psm2:// -c 1 -D 20 -t 0,0
echo "## Margo OFI/PSM2 (bw, 1MiB, 8x concurrency, bdw, Hg busy spin):"
mpirun numactl -N 0 -m 0 ./margo-p2p-bw -x 1048576 -n ofi+psm2://enp6s0f0:5000 -c 8 -D 20 -t 0,0
mpirun numactl -N 0 -m 0 ./margo-p2p-bw -x 1048576 -n psm2:// -c 8 -D 20 -t 0,0
echo "## Margo OFI/PSM2 (bw, 8MiB, bdw, Hg busy spin):"
mpirun numactl -N 0 -m 0 ./margo-p2p-bw -x 8388608 -n ofi+psm2://enp6s0f0:5000 -c 1 -D 20 -t 0,0
mpirun numactl -N 0 -m 0 ./margo-p2p-bw -x 8388608 -n psm2:// -c 1 -D 20 -t 0,0
echo "## Margo OFI/PSM2 (bw, 8MiB, 8x concurrency, bdw, Hg busy spin):"
mpirun numactl -N 0 -m 0 ./margo-p2p-bw -x 8388608 -n ofi+psm2://enp6s0f0:5000 -c 8 -D 20 -t 0,0
mpirun numactl -N 0 -m 0 ./margo-p2p-bw -x 8388608 -n psm2:// -c 8 -D 20 -t 0,0
echo "## Margo OFI/PSM2 (bw, 1MB unaligned, bdw, Hg busy spin):"
mpirun numactl -N 0 -m 0 ./margo-p2p-bw -x 1000000 -n ofi+psm2://enp6s0f0:5000 -c 1 -D 20 -t 0,0
mpirun numactl -N 0 -m 0 ./margo-p2p-bw -x 1000000 -n psm2:// -c 1 -D 20 -t 0,0
echo "## Margo OFI/PSM2 (bw, 1MB unaligned, 8x concurrency, bdw, Hg busy spin):"
mpirun numactl -N 0 -m 0 ./margo-p2p-bw -x 1000000 -n ofi+psm2://enp6s0f0:5000 -c 8 -D 20 -t 0,0
mpirun numactl -N 0 -m 0 ./margo-p2p-bw -x 1000000 -n psm2:// -c 8 -D 20 -t 0,0
# echo "## Margo OFI/PSM2 (bw, 8MiB, mmap shmfs on svr, bdw, Hg busy spin):"
# mpirun numactl -N 0 -m 0 ./margo-p2p-bw -x 8388608 -n ofi+psm2://enp6s0f0:5000 -c 1 -D 20 -t 0,0 -m /dev/shm/foo
# mpirun numactl -N 0 -m 0 ./margo-p2p-bw -x 8388608 -n psm2:// -c 1 -D 20 -t 0,0 -m /dev/shm/foo
# echo "## Margo OFI/PSM2 (bw, 8MiB, mmap shmfs on svr, 8x concurrency, bdw, Hg busy spin):"
# mpirun numactl -N 0 -m 0 ./margo-p2p-bw -x 8388608 -n ofi+psm2://enp6s0f0:5000 -c 8 -D 20 -t 0,0 -m /dev/shm/foo
# mpirun numactl -N 0 -m 0 ./margo-p2p-bw -x 8388608 -n psm2:// -c 8 -D 20 -t 0,0 -m /dev/shm/foo
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ment